Fix a crash caused by SIP addresses containing "%40" instead of "@"
CallerInfo.doSecondaryLookupIfNecessary() was assuming that SIP addresses would always contain the character '@', but that's not always true since the username/domainname delimiter can actually be "%40" (the URI-escaped equivalent.) This would cause the in-call UI to crash if you ever called a SIP address like "xyz%40example.com". TESTED: - Make an outgoing call to the SIP address "xyz%40example.com" ==> The call ultimately fails, but the in-call UI no longer crashes when it first comes up. /**
+ * @return the "username" part of the specified SIP address,
+ * i.e. the part before the "@" character (or "%40").
+ *
+ * @param number SIP address of the form "username@domainname"
+ * (or the URI-escaped equivalent "username%40domainname")
+ * @see isUriNumber
+ *
+ * @hide
+ */
+ public static String getUsernameFromUriNumber(String number) {
+ // The delimiter between username and domain name can be
+ // either "@" or "%40" (the URI-escaped equivalent.)
+ int delimiterIndex = number.indexOf('@');
+ if (delimiterIndex < 0) {
+ delimiterIndex = number.indexOf("%40");
+ }
+ if (delimiterIndex < 0) {
+ Log.w(LOG_TAG,
+ "getUsernameFromUriNumber: no delimiter found in SIP addr '" + number + "'");
+ delimiterIndex = number.length();
+ }
+ return number.substring(0, delimiterIndex);
+ }
